Manara Minerals to acquire up to 20% stake in Pakistan's Reko …

Saudi Arabian mining fund Manara Minerals is set to acquire a 10–20% stake in the Reko Diq copper-gold project in Pakistan. The acquisition, valued at between $500m (SR1.88bn) and $1bn, involves purchasing the stake from the Pakistan Government, which, along with the province of Balochistan, owns half of the project, according to a report by the Financial …

About – Pakistan The Mineral Marvel

Pakistan has a history of success in the extractive industry with oil and gas upstream businesses being at the forefront. Key successes such as the discovery of the giant gas field at Sui in Balochistan in 1952 followed by accelerated exploration and production of hydrocarbons in subsequent decades enabled various state-owned companies to grow into sizeable enterprises.
